Key Materials for Walk-In Shower Durability
The foundation of a lasting walk-in shower lies in premium materials. Opt for moisture-resistant glass or tempered acrylic for doors, stainless steel or brass fixtures for a sleek finish, and waterproof membrane or cement backer board for walls and floors. Using corrosion-resistant materials protects against mold, mildew, and water damage, ensuring longevity even in high-humidity environments.
Design Principles for Functional and Stylish Showers
A well-designed walk-in shower maximizes space and usability. Key elements include a sloped, non-slip floor to prevent water pooling, strategically placed handholds for safety, and ample vertical ventilation—either through a fan or ceiling-mounted exhaust—to reduce condensation. Incorporating recessed lighting and integrated storage optimizes both aesthetics and convenience, creating a spa-like retreat within your home.
